BATAVIA — After laying in wait for over seven-eighths of the mile, Stranger Things found a gap late and shot through it to narrowly win the $12,800 Open Handicap pacing feature at Batavia Downs on Saturday night.

Shawn McDonough got away third with Stranger Things as Fulsome (Kyle Swift) and Lip Reader A (Drew Monti) traded leads through the 27.2-second quarter. Lip Reader A finally gained control in turn two and then rolled past the half and to three-quarters, where Egomania (Jim Morrill Jr.) had moved first-over and was third in the breeze, just outside of Stranger Things, as the race entered the last turn. Positions remained unchanged until they entered the stretch where Egomania tired and drifted out, allowing McDonough to tip Stranger Things off the pegs and take a run at the leader.
